Thanks to the Government's NHS Pharmacy First initiative, you no longer need a GP appointment to manage a number of common conditions.

The conditions treatable under NHS Pharmacy First are:

• Uncomplicated urinary tract infection, or UTI
• Sore throat
• Sinusitis
• Impetigo
• Shingles
• Infected insect bites

What is the NHS Pharmacy First scheme?

The NHS Pharmacy First scheme allows pharmacists and chemists to prescribe specific medication for common ailments and illnesses without the need to visit a doctor. These ailments include a sore throat, sinusitis, impetigo, an infected insect bite, shingles, and uncomplex UTIs in women.

Can you buy antibiotics over the counter?

Through the new NHS Pharmacy First scheme pharmacists are now able to supply antibiotics and other prescription only medication where clinically appropriate.

What is the difference between a pharmacist and a chemist?

In the UK, a chemist is the traditional name for a pharmacist. Looking up ‘Chemist near me’ on your favourite search engine will usually bring up results for local pharmacies.
